Job Description

Job Title : Event Assistant
Location : Philadelphia, PA
Job Type : Full-Time
Reports To : Event Manager

Job Summary

We are seeking a highly organized, enthusiastic, and detail-oriented individual to join our team as an Event Assistant. The Event Assistant will play a key role in supporting the planning, coordination, and execution of events, ensuring seamless operations and exceptional experiences for attendees. This is a great opportunity for someone with strong multitasking skills, creativity, and a passion for events.

Key Responsibilities

  • Coordinate logistics such as venue bookings, vendor management, and equipment setup.
  • Help create and maintain event schedules, timelines, and budgets.
  • Communicate with vendors, suppliers, and internal teams to ensure smooth event operations.
  • Support on-site event setup, including decorations, signage, and seating arrangements.
  • Serve as a point of contact for attendees during events, addressing inquiries or resolving issues promptly.
  • Conduct post-event evaluations, gather feedback, and compile reports to assess the event's success.
  • Perform administrative duties, such as preparing event materials, processing invoices, and maintaining databases.
  • Stay informed about event trends, technologies, and best practices.

Qualifications and Skills

  • High school diploma or equivalent; a degree in Event Management, Hospitality, Marketing, or a related field is a plus.
  • Exceptional organizational and time-management skills, with the 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and familiarity with event management software (e.g., Eventbrite, Cvent, etc.) is a plus.
  • Ability to work flexible hours, including evenings, weekends, and holidays, as needed.
  • Problem-solving skills and the ability to remain calm under pressure.
